Kindergarten ELAR Unit 1

Getting to Know You

8 Instructional Days - 1st 6 Weeks

Hyperlinks are for content teachers

Big Idea:

  • Understanding that letters make words and that words have meaning.

Writing and Grammar: Writing My Name

Phonics: Letters in My Name

Student Expectations:

Priority TEKS

Phonics:

K.2(Dv) identifying all uppercase and lowercase letters

Writing:

K.10(Dvii) Edit drafts with adult assistance using standard English conventions, including: capitalization of the first letter in a sentence and name

Focus TEKS

Reading:

K.6(A) describe personal connections to a variety of sources

Ongoing TEKS

1.A, 1.B, 1.C, 1.D, 1.E, 6.A

Student Learning Targets:

  • I will identify the letters in my name.
  • I will write my first name.
  • I will make real-world connections to the stories we read.

Essential Questions:

  • What is the first letter in your name?
  • How do you spell your name?
  • What connection did you make to the story?
